A simple idea supports science: "trust, but verify". Results should always be【C1】________to challenge from experiment. That simple but powerful idea has【C2】________a vast body of knowledge.【C3】________its birth in the 17th century, modern science has changed the world【C4】________ recognition, and overwhelmingly for the better.
But success can【C5】________self-contentment. Modern scientists are doing too much trusting and not enough verifying, which does harm to both the whole of science and humanity.
Too many of the【C6】________that fill the academic field are the result of inferior experiments or poor analysis. A rule of thumb among biotechnology venture-capitalists is that half of【C7】________research cannot be reproduced. Even that may be【C8】________. Last year researchers at one biotech firm, Amgen, found they could reproduce just six of 53 "landmark" studies in cancer research. Earlier, a group at Bayer, a drug company,【C9】________to repeat just a quarter of 67 similarly important papers. A leading computer scientist complains that three-quarters of papers in his subfield are nonsense.
The reasons might lie in this: researchers are no longer willing to verify hypothesis investigated by other scholars since these papers have rare chance to be published. All this makes a poor foundation for an enterprise dedicated【C10】________discovering the truth about the world What might be done to shore it up? One【C11】________ should be for all disciplines to follow the example of those that have done most to tighten standards.
【C12】________research protocols should be registered in advance and monitored in virtual notebooks. This would【C13】________the temptation to distort the experiment’s design so as to make the results look more【C14】________ than they are.【C15】________possible, trial data also should be open for other researchers to【C16】________and test.
Science still【C17】________enormous respect. But its privileged【C18】________is founded on the capacity to be right most of the time and to correct its mistakes when it gets things wrong. And it is not as if the universe is short of【C19】________mysteries to keep generations of scientists hard【C20】________. The false trails laid down by inferior research are an unforgivable barrier to understanding.
【C11】
选项
A、priority
B、inclination
C、barrier
D、challenge
答案
A
解析
本句用于回答前一句所提出的问题,其中shore sth. up意为“支撑”,问题问怎么做才能让这个根基变得牢固起来。空格后的should be表明建议和解决办法。A项priority“优先考虑的事”代入句中后,上下文逻辑通顺。B项inclination“倾向”表示发展趋势,此处无此意义。C项barrier“障碍”和D项challenge“挑战”后面都应接存在的问题,而此处空格后是提出解决的办法。
